Amalfi Coast Experience



What makes the Amalfi Coastline a motorcyclist's paradise? This magnificent region provides spectacular views, winding roads, and a vibrant neighborhood culture that bids riders from around the globe. The famous SS163, likewise referred to as the Amalfi Drive, features remarkable high cliffs, stunning towns, and the sparkling Tyrrhenian Sea. Each turn discloses spectacular landscapes, from lavish terraced gardens to captivating coastal towns like Positano and Ravello. Motorcyclists can experience exciting spins and turns while enjoying the aroma of lemon groves and the attraction of ancient architecture. Additionally, the coastal wind and warm environment improve the experience. The mix of all-natural charm and abundant history makes the Amalfi Coast an unforgettable location for motorcyclists seeking both exhilaration and peacefulness on their journey.


Tuscan Countryside Getaway



After experiencing the seaside allure of the Amalfi Shore, bikers can shift their emphasis to the charming landscapes of the Tuscan countryside. amalfi coast motorcycle tours. This region supplies a tapestry of rolling hillsides, wineries, and enchanting middle ages communities. The Chianti course is especially preferred, winding through legendary red wine nation with picturesque drops in towns like Greve and Radda. One more scenic choice is the Val d'Orcia, where bikers can admire cypress-lined roads and sensational views that evoke Renaissance art. The journey through the Crete Senesi showcases special clay hillsides and rustic farmhouses, welcoming travelers to enjoy neighborhood cuisine and glass of wines. Each route not just promises impressive views but likewise an immersive experience in the rich culture and history of Tuscany


Dolomites Mountain Experience



The breathtaking Dolomites provide a bike enthusiast's paradise, with winding roadways that cut via dramatic hill landscapes and charming towering towns. One of the top picturesque paths, the Great Dolomites Roadway, extends from Bolzano to Cortina d'Ampezzo, showcasing stunning vistas of rugged tops and rich valleys. One more must-ride is the Sella Ronda loop, a round route that takes riders via the heart of the Dolomites, using spectacular views every which way. Motorcyclists can also check out the picturesque passes of Passo Gardena and Passo Pordoi, renowned for their hairpin bends and scenic perspectives. Each course welcomes motorcyclists to experience the unique mix of nature, culture, and history that the Dolomites have to supply, making it an extraordinary adventure.

Browsing Italian Web Traffic Rules



Understanding Italian website traffic policies is essential for a secure and delightful bike tour. Italy implements strict guidelines, and bikers must acquaint themselves with neighborhood legislations. Motorcyclists are called for to use safety helmets in any way times, and reflective vests are obligatory when quit on the roadway. Speed limitations differ; metropolitan areas typically enable 50 km/h, while highways permit as much as 130 km/h. It's crucial to value the right of means, particularly at roundabouts, where automobiles within have priority. Furthermore, Italian cities usually have ZTL (Minimal Traffic Areas), which limit access to non-residents. Riders ought to stay attentive for hostile motorists and be gotten ready for unforeseen habits. Abiding by these policies improves security and assures a smoother journey through Italy's picturesque landscapes.
